Buying Guide

Match period to your interests

Choose works focused on the era you study—early church, medieval, Reformation, Victorian, or twentieth-century theology—for targeted historical context

Prioritize source or analysis

Decide whether you need primary documents and documents anthologies for source work or interpretive monographs for context and argumentation

Look for academic apparatus

Prefer books with footnotes, bibliographies, and indexes to support further research and classroom use

Consider denominational and geographic scope

Select titles that reflect the traditions or regions you study—Anglican, Jesuit, American, or global perspectives—to avoid narrow framing

Check author and publisher credentials

Give weight to scholars, edited conference volumes, and university press publications for credibility and rigorous scholarship
